- 新增 start.sh 脚本用于启动 Logic 服务器 - 更新 docker-compose.yml 文件,将 entrypoint 改为 start.sh - 优化服务器启动流程,提高自动化程度
		
			
				
	
	
		
			31 lines
		
	
	
		
			719 B
		
	
	
	
		
			YAML
		
	
	
	
	
	
			
		
		
	
	
			31 lines
		
	
	
		
			719 B
		
	
	
	
		
			YAML
		
	
	
	
	
	
| version: '3.8'
 | |
| 
 | |
| services:
 | |
|   server:
 | |
|     image: chuanqi-os:latest
 | |
|     container_name: chuanqi-server-dev
 | |
|     cpus: '2'
 | |
|     stdin_open: true
 | |
|     volumes:
 | |
|       - .:/data/server/s1
 | |
|       - ./wch:/etc/yum/wch
 | |
|     entrypoint: "/data/server/s1/run.sh"
 | |
|     network_mode: "host"
 | |
|     restart: unless-stopped
 | |
|     environment:
 | |
|       TZ: Asia/Shanghai
 | |
|   logic:
 | |
|     image: chuanqi-os:latest
 | |
|     container_name: chuanqi-server-logic
 | |
|     cpus: '4'
 | |
|     cpuset: '13,14,15,16'
 | |
|     stdin_open: true
 | |
|     volumes:
 | |
|       - ./LogicServer:/data/server/s1/LogicServer
 | |
|       - ./wch:/etc/yum/wch
 | |
|     entrypoint: "/data/server/s1/LogicServer/start.sh"
 | |
|     network_mode: "host"
 | |
|     restart: unless-stopped
 | |
|     environment:
 | |
|       TZ: Asia/Shanghai
 |